What is the gcf of 5x4 +20x3 + 15x2

Respuesta :

SilverChain SilverChain
  • 03-04-2021

Answer:

5x^2

Step-by-step explanation

By looking at the coefficients, the greatest common factor between 5, 20, and 15 is 5. By looking at the variables, the greatest common factor between x^4, x^3, and x^2 is x^2.

Therefore, the greatest common factor is 5x^2
